Melbourne lost four players in Park, Odgers, Daniels and Cowell before the game but had good players to replace them in Sykes, Cope and Mills. After a close game they came out on top, but could have won by more if they'd kicked straight.

Despite generally being the second best team St Kilda at least worked the ball into good scoring positions before taking shots, while Melbourne's forwards were often given shots on difficult angles. Eventually weight of numbers won out for the home side.

St Kilda had a chance of taking the lead early in the last quarter, but they hit the post and could never get their nose in front. Each side had shots towards the end, with Brereton and Coutie kicking the sealing goals before St Kilda got a consolation.

Strong, Brereton and Norman were Melbourne's best.
